Rumbek Centre is a 3,853 km² city in Lakes, South Sudan with a population of 220,444.
The nearest HV substation is 179.9 km away. The nearest transmission grid line is 395.1 km away.
The nearest fiber route is 432.9 km from the city boundary. The nearest IXP is 784.6 km away. The nearest subsea landing station is 631.2 km away.
The city faces River Flood, Wildfire as primary natural hazard risks. Extreme Heat are at moderate levels. Overall hazard score: 2.0/3.
Between 2020–2025, 502 conflict events were recorded (trend: stable). Most recent year (2025): 61 events. Stability score: 1.1/3.
Water stress is rated Extremely High (score 5.0/5 on the WRI Aqueduct scale).
